Output 5fe29b606f090809eb5917565d9efbf74e7ccf9773b72ee9e0cd06ece882c609:19

value
685519
script pubkey
OP_HASH160 OP_PUSHBYTES_20 75bc2bfee25bca3009a2e0665800537876186ed2 OP_EQUAL
address
3CRYQQ2W6PS75gMz1iJSDXxDGcgAaHN4NL
transaction
5fe29b606f090809eb5917565d9efbf74e7ccf9773b72ee9e0cd06ece882c609
spent
true